« Wiley Publishes First Podcasting How-To Book | Main | PodNova Intros Web-Based Podcatcher »World's First Podcast-Based Radio Station Goes Live Monday, May 16May 13, 2005Infinity Broadcasting's KYOURADIO, the world's first podcast-based radio station, is set to launch on Monday, May 16 at 9:00 AM, ET. KYOURADIO will feature podcasts created exclusively by its listeners, and be available in San Francisco at 1550 KYCY-AM and streamed online at www.kyouradio.com. The station's inaugural podcast will be from Dave Winer, a software developer who was instrumental in the development of podcasting technology. Users began uploading their podcasts to KYOURADIO on Wednesday, April 27, the day the station was first announced. Once uploaded, podcasts become eligible to be selected for broadcast. Since then, more than 400 podcasts have been uploaded from users in 49 states, as well as cities across the world, including London, Toronto and Hong Kong. Submitted podcasts are of varying lengths covering a wide range of topics, including, views on life in San Francisco, thoughts pondered while commuting, highlights from the world of science, time travel, amusement parks, and the best in bluegrass, indie, rock and Asian music, among many others. Programming on the station will be determined by listener interests and feedback, and evaluated on a daily basis. Podcasting technology, made popular in late 2004, allows users to create and upload their own audio programs on the Internet which can be downloaded to multimedia players at a later date. The software also lets users subscribe to their favorite podcasts and have them sent automatically to their players for listening at their convenience. Podcasts broadcast on KYCY-AM and streamed online will not be available for download. Infinity, a division of Viacom, operates 180 radio stations, with stations covering the news, modern rock, oldies, country, FM talk, classic rock and urban formats.
